Conventional fertilizer programs focus on the macronutrients like Nitrogen (N), Phosphorus (P) and Potassium (K). Cation Exchange Capacity (CEC) refers to the capacity of exchange between a cation (a positively charged ion) in solution, in the soil, and another cation on the surface of any negatively charged material such as AZOMITE. Technically, AZOMITE is a highly mineralized complex silica ore (Hydrated Sodium Calcium Aluminosilicate or HSCAS), mined in Utah from an ancient deposit left by a volcanic eruption that filled a small seabed an estimated 30 million years ago. Micronized AZOMITE powder is 90% passing a 200 mesh screen and can be mixed with potting soil, compost, or spread by hand in the garden or other agricultural production areas or used in hydroponic or liquid application systems where strong agitation and proper filter, emitter, and/or nozzle sizes are in place to allow the non-soluble particles to flow through.
